Learning unit contents
The lecture includes all aspects related to natural risks : hazards, vulnerability, disaster response, risk mitigation...
applied to earthquakes, mass movements, volcanic and hydro-meteorologic hazards,.. with focus on hazard couplingmechanisms.
Both scientific and socio-economic aspects are considered.
For students in engineering sciences, complementary geomorphic aspects are added to the basic lecture in geological risk assessment.
Learning outcomes of the learning unit
The goal is to understand the coupling between hazards as well as the link between hazard and risk.
